Что такое CDN и почему требуются сети передачи контента
CDN представляет собой географически распределённую инфраструктуру для быстрой передачи веб-контента клиентам. Система включает из серверов, размещённых в разных местах мира. Первостепенная цель CDN заключается в снижении времени открытия веб-страниц, изображений и видеофайлов. Система отправляет данные с ближайшего географического пункта, уменьшая дистанцию между аппаратом пин ап клиента и источником информации.
Вопрос скорости подгрузки порталов
Скорость подгрузки веб-ресурсов сказывается на пользовательский впечатление и финансовые показатели организации. Медленная передача материалов увеличивает показатель отказов и уменьшает продажи. Пользователи ожидают мгновенной подгрузки страниц пин ап, задержка в несколько секунд порождает отрицательную реакцию.
Территориальное промежуток между сервером и посетителем формирует естественные препятствия отправки сведений. Обращение от клиента из Азии к серверу в Европе преодолевает тысячи километров, повышая задержку. Каждый маршрутизатор на маршруте передвижения пакетов вносит миллисекунды паузы.
Значительная нагруженность на единственный сервер замедляет обработку обращений всех пользователей. Пиковые моменты образуют последовательности обращений, которые машина не поспевает исполнять. Ограниченная пропускная способность линии становится критичным участком при отправке мультимедийного контента.
Актуальные веб-страницы содержат массу компонентов: фотографии, ролики, скрипты и таблицы стилей. Суммарный вес загружаемых данных pin up достигает нескольких мегабайт. Мобильные устройства уязвимы к сложностям скорости из-за непостоянства мобильных каналов.
Как работает сеть распространения контента
Сеть передачи материалов работает по методу географического рассредоточения реплик сведений между узлами. Оператор CDN располагает пункты присутствия в разных регионах, выстраивая международную систему. Когда клиент обращается веб-страницу, система устанавливает ближайший к нему сервер.
DNS-маршрутизация направляет обращение к оптимальному узлу на основе территориального положения посетителя. Механизмы оценивают загрузку серверов, наличие соединений и стабильность соединения. Платформа назначает пункт с минимальным периодом ответа.
Краевой сервер контролирует существование запрашиваемого данных в региональном репозитории. Если дубликат присутствует и современна, машина отправляет информацию клиенту. Отсутствие данных пин ап казино запускает обращение к источнику для получения подлинника.
Загруженный контент сохраняется на краевом узле для дальнейших запросов. Дальнейшие посетители из области получают сведения из местного кэша без обращения к центральному узлу. Система дублирования выравнивает материал между точками присутствия. Модификация документов инициирует удаление неактуальных копий в распространённой системе.
Ключевые компоненты CDN-инфраструктуры
Архитектура системы доставки содержимого содержит из связанных технических элементов. Каждый модуль реализует определённые функции пин ап в течении передачи информации пользователям.
- Краевые машины находятся пространственно рядом к целевым клиентам. Пункты сберегают кэшированные дубликаты содержимого и исполняют приходящие обращения. Рассредоточение узлов по континентам минимизирует фактическое расстояние транспортировки информации.
- Главный узел включает первоначальные варианты всех файлов веб-ресурса. Пограничные узлы запрашивают к первоисточнику при нехватке материалов в местном кэше. Основное репозиторий сохраняет свежесть данных в распределённой структуре.
- Платформа администрирования содержимым организует работу всех пунктов инфраструктуры. Платформа отслеживает положение машин, рассредоточивает загрузку и управляет записью. Контрольная панель даёт настраивать параметры исполнения документов.
- Балансировщики нагрузки распределяют приходящий поток между активными машинами. Системы оценивают нагрузку пунктов и отправляют обращения к менее свободным машинам. Система предотвращает переполнение при резком росте трафика.
Кэширование документов на распределенных машинах
Запись представляет собой запись дубликатов данных на территориально рассредоточенных серверах. Методика даёт хранить постоянный содержимое ближе к клиентам, сокращая период передачи. Периферийные пункты создают местные копии фотографий, видео, таблиц стилей и скриптов.
Методы сохранения устанавливают принципы хранения разнообразных видов содержимого. Постоянные данные записываются на продолжительный период, поскольку редко модифицируются. Изменяемый материал требует частого модификации или исключения из кэша. Конфигурации времени актуальности сказываются на соотношение между свежестью и быстродействием доставки.
Механизм инвалидации устраняет неактуальные версии данных из распределённого репозитория. При обновлении контента пин ап казино система высылает уведомления краевым пунктам о нужде модификации. Система очистки гарантирует согласование информации между пунктами присутствия.
Заголовки HTTP регулируют поведением сохранения на разных уровнях структуры. Инструкции Cache-Control указывают условия записи и актуализации файлов. Параметры ETag позволяют сверять современность содержимого без полноценной скачивания. Условные вызовы уменьшают передачу информации при отсутствии изменений.
Как CDN уменьшает нагруженность на основной машину
Разделение запросов между пограничными узлами разгружает главный машину от выполнения дублирующихся вызовов. Большая часть вызовов к постоянному материалам исполняются региональными узлами без задействования главного узла. Главная машина выполняет только особые запросы и изменяемый контент.
Сохранение неизменных ресурсов убирает потребность многократной отправки идентичных данных. Фотографии, видео и таблицы стилей загружаются с основного машины разово, далее предоставляются из кэша. Уменьшение вызовов к центральному серверу разгружает системные мощности для сложных действий.
Пропускная способность линии центрального узла тратится экономнее при задействовании CDN. Передача мультимедийного материалов происходит через распределённую систему узлов. Главный узел высылает информацию только на точки присутствия, а не каждому пользователю.
Географическое разделение загрузки исключает перенагрузку центрального пункта в периоды значительной активности. Пиковые загрузки распределяются между серверами в разных зонах. Устойчивость структуры pin up повышается благодаря копированию возможностей между независимыми пунктами.
Защита от перенагрузок и DDoS-атак
Система передачи содержимого предоставляет защиту веб-ресурсов от распространённых вторжений типа отказ в обслуживании. Территориальное рассредоточение узлов обеспечивает принимать большие количества злонамеренного объёма без воздействия на функционирование. Злонамеренные вызовы распределяются между множеством серверов вместо концентрации на отдельном сервере.
Фильтрация трафика на уровне периферийных машин блокирует сомнительные вызовы до попадания главного сервера. Системы исследуют модели действий и определяют аномальную поведение. Системы машинного обучения распознают признаки автоматизированных нападений и ботнетов. Блокировка вредоносных IP-адресов осуществляется автономно.
Контроль темпа запросов пин ап казино исключает перенагрузку от одного источника. Система rate limiting устанавливает предельное число запросов с адреса за промежуток. Переход лимита приводит к краткосрочной отсечению отправителя.
Дополнительная производительность рассредоточенной структуры позволяет преодолевать с неожиданными пиками легитимного потока. Гибкость системы гарантирует обработку возросшего количества обращений без ухудшения эффективности. Автоматическое перенос загрузки возмещает сбой единичных серверов при нападениях.
Достоинства и ограничения CDN
Применение системы передачи контента даёт массу плюсов для обладателей веб-ресурсов. Методика устраняет важнейшие проблемы эффективности пин ап и работоспособности.
- Ускорение подгрузки веб-страниц повышает удовлетворённость пользователей и оптимизирует активностные факторы. Снижение периода ответа благоприятно влияет на продажи и коммерческие индикаторы.
- Сокращение нагруженности на главный сервер сохраняет вычислительные мощности и издержки на систему. Настройка пропускной мощности линии уменьшает затраты на объём.
- Повышение надёжности обеспечивает работоспособность веб-ресурса при неполадках единичных узлов. Пространственное дублирование ограждает от местных технических сбоев.
- Оборона от DDoS-атак исключает отказ ресурса при злонамеренных действиях. Распределённая система поглощает опасный поток без влияния на законных клиентов.
Ограничения системы предполагают учёта при разработке развёртывания. Стоимость услуг поставщиков может быть существенной для проектов с большими объёмами потока. Установка кэширования динамического контента нуждается усилий разработчиков. Привязка от стороннего оператора формирует угрозы при программных неполадках.
Где используются системы доставки контента
Системы доставки контента получают применение в различных сферах онлайн экономики. Методика стала нормой для организаций, оперирующих с огромными массивами объёма.
Системы стримингового видео задействуют CDN для распространения контента миллионам пользователям параллельно. Сервисы онлайн-кинотеатров гарантируют проигрывание роликов без буферизации. Распространённая система преодолевает с пиковыми загрузками во время премьер известных картин.
Интернет-магазины используют CDN для ускорения открытия перечней изделий и изображений изделий. Оперативная передача материалов важна для превращения клиентов в заказчиков. Паузы при просмотре товаров приводят к сокращению продаж.
Медийные сайты задействуют рассредоточенную структуру для обработки пиков объёма при публикации резонансных материалов. Сеть обеспечивает функционирование сайта при резком увеличении числа читателей. Картинки и видеофайлы загружаются стремительно вне зависимости от территориального положения зрителей.
Игровые платформы передают патчи через CDN миллионам клиентам. Распределение документов инсталляции pin up происходит эффективнее через территориально ближние машины. Бизнес порталы и образовательные сервисы задействуют технологию для глобального покрытия.